I bought 16 of these and mounted them onto a piece of wood. I put a self-adhesive rubber pad on the bottom to keep the mini transfer table in place. So, what is it for? Well, I have summer tires and winter tires which are mounted on their own wheels. With this thing I made, it is a piece of cake to change out the tire sets. I can push the wheel up flush to the hub and rotate the wheel to align the lug nut holes (my lug nuts have a male end). I don't have to try to hold the wheel in place with one hand (very difficult) and try to thread a lug nut with the other.

Do not overload these rolling bearings
Watch the weight limits. If you put these on furniture or a rolling cabinet, watch the weight limit! If you exceed the weight limit, these bearings self-destruct. The inner bearings become deformed and start flying out of the assembly, and they are then defective and useless. This is not a defect, it is that the consumer must pay attention to weight limits. When I put them on a cabinet, the cabinet was empty. All seemed fine. Then I overloaded the cabinet and that is why they failed. Watch the weight limits!
